Improper temperature when baking.
Moved the stove away from the wall, unhooked the electric cord and the gas pipe. In the oven, undid the two screws holding the probe. Removed two screws and removed the electrical cover panel from the stove back, disconnected the quick connect to the probe and pulled the probe from the oven. Reversding the proceedures, put the new probe into the oven, hooked up the quick connect and replaced the electrical panel cover. From the front, reinstalled the probe with the two screws, reconnected the gas and the power cord and put the stove back into position. It works just fine now!

Oven did not work since bake element did not warm up.
Square drive screws used throughout the oven since its manufactured in Canada. Shut power down to the range. Element fastener plate removed and 2 electrical terminals loosened. Used a pair of hemostats to hold on to the wires so as not to lose them to the interior back of the oven which was loaded with insulation. Connected the 2 wires to the new element, screwed the element fastening plate with element back to the back of the oven wall. Turned power back on and voila, I was back in business.

Oven would not heat above 250 degrees
This repair was easy, but I would not have even tried if I hadn't read the tips from other DIYers - thanks! The website questions and schematic along with some common sense testing isolated the problem with the oven only heating up to 250 degrees. Since the broiler (upper element) worked ok, that made it likely that the temperature sensor was not the problem. That made almost certain that the bake (cooking) element was the problem. So, I ordered the part, which was delivered quickly. Early on the morning of the scheduled delivery date, I turned off the oven power at the fuse box and pulled the oven away from the wall. There were only 4 screws to remove in order to take off the rear panel. The bake element was attached to two slide-on connectors, one of which looked charred and partially disconnected. I cleaned the charred connector, reattached it to the bake element, turned the power back on, and then turned the oven on. The charred connection glowed, so I immediately turned off the oven and the power. I disconnected the bad connector, cut it off from the wire, and stripped the wire to prepare for a new connector, which cost 30 cents at the hardware store. The bake element connection was cleaned, and then the new connector was attached. The power was turned back on, and then the oven was turned on, and it heated perfectly. After confirming several heatings over several hours, the rear panel was reattached, and the oven was pushed back to the wall. This expensive 40" dual fuel oven had been purchased new and used for 3 years by the prior owners of our home. The oven's computer brain died when the oven was 7 years old - the repair cost us $500 for professional labor, parts, and materials. I don't know if I could have done that repair, but I had no intention of shelling that much again, which is why I tried this bake element repair myself. The oven is now 11 years old, and the most likely part to fail is the original bake element. So, we may keep the new part as insurance with the hope of making a fast, easy, inexpensive repair when the original bake element eventually fails.
